Buying Guide for Outdoor Grill Cleaners
Choosing the right grill cleaner depends on several important factors to ensure both effective cleaning and safety. Consider these when selecting a product:
Type of Grill and Surface Material
Check if the cleaner is compatible with your grill’s surface—stainless steel, cast iron, porcelain-enameled, or ceramic grates require different cleaning approaches. Some formulas are safe on food surfaces and suitable for electric or pellet grills, while others may be too harsh.
Cleaning Power and Ingredients
Look for products with strong grease-cutting abilities, especially if you grill frequently. Biodegradable and citrus-based cleaners offer natural degreasing without harsh chemicals. Super-strength gels or specialized sprays remove build-up efficiently, but ensure they don’t leave residues.
Safety for Users and Food Preparation
Avoid cleaners with harmful chemicals that could cause skin irritation or contaminate food. Non-toxic, non-flammable formulas with low irritants are preferred. Additionally, brush options that are bristle-free minimize risks of ingesting wire fragments.
Ease of Use and Maintenance
Consider ergonomic handles, spray bottles, and detachable or refillable cleaning heads. Brushes with flexible bristles or scrapers designed to clean edges speed up maintenance. Look for products that clean quickly on cool grills to avoid damage or burns.
Environmental and Health Considerations
Biodegradable and phosphate-free products are better for the environment and reduce flare-ups or excessive smoke during cooking. Citrus-based cleaners unify effective cleaning with fewer hazardous effects on users and surroundings.
